Bill Summary

AN ACT TO APPROPRIATE FUNDS FOR THE PAULI MURRAY CENTER IN DURHAM.

AI Summary

This bill appropriates $150,000 in nonrecurring funds from the General Fund to the Office of State Budget and Management for the 2025-2026 fiscal year, specifically to provide a directed grant to the Pauli Murray Center for History and Social Justice. The funds are designated for developing the Pauli Murray Center Green, which will improve the center's functional access and install critical drainage and stormwater management systems. The Pauli Murray Center, named after the renowned civil rights activist, lawyer, and poet Pauli Murray, is located in Durham, North Carolina. The bill specifies that the funding will become effective on July 1, 2025, and is a one-time appropriation aimed at supporting the physical infrastructure of this historically significant cultural center.
